Media Monopoly and Ownership

Abstract: 6 pages. The fact that a mere handful of corporations own the entire media monopoly should cause all of us to stop and realize what this means. When the media is controlled by a monopoly, we are not getting diverse information; we are being fed exactly what the monopolies want us to digest. And the problem herein is that they are not looking out for what is best for us as citizens, but rather, what is best for them as in bottom line corporate profit. Bibliography lists 6 sources.
